How to Use This IFSC Code
NEFT Transfer
Use IFSC code SBIN0004507 to send money via NEFT to this branch. NEFT transfers are processed in hourly batches during working hours. No minimum amount required.
RTGS Transfer
This branch supports RTGS for high-value instant transfers above ₹2 lakhs. Use the same IFSC code SBIN0004507.
IMPS Transfer
IMPS is available 24×7 including holidays. Maximum ₹5 lakhs per transaction. Use IFSC code SBIN0004507.
IFSC Code Structure
S
B
I
N
0
0
0
4
5
0
7
- SBIN — Bank code (State Bank of India)
- 0 — Reserved (always 0)
- 004507 — Branch code (KUNI)
